GENETIC DIVERGENCE STUDY OF SAFFLOWER (CARTHAMUS TINCTORIUS L.) USING MOLECULAR MARKERS

摘要

A study was carried out at PMAS Arid Agriculture University, Rawalpindi, Pakistan during theyear 2016 to assess genetic divergence among 36 local and 30 exotic safflower (Carthamustinctorius L.) accessions utilizing random amplified polymorphic DNA (RAPD) markers. Theresults revealed that out of 15 RAPD primers, seven were polymorphic. Further, the amplificationproduct yielded 64 number of total loci with 6.4 as an average number of alleles for each loci inlocal accessions whereas 72 number of total loci with 7.2 as an average number of alleles foreach loci in exotic germplasm. The values of similarity co-efficient for local and exotic germplasmranged from 0.32 (32 percent) to 1.00 (100 percent) and 0.40 (40 percent) to 1.00 (100 percent),respectively. Cluster analysis based on the data from RAPD markers, divided local germplasminto two distinct groups, which revealed two unique genotypes L6 and L21. Similarly, in exoticgermplasm, cluster analysis dividedexotic germplasm into two distinct groups and showed threeunique genotypes E3, E5 and E28 which were found to be the most diverse in the germplasm.
